General Purpose of Job:
Ensure that all patients on the are scheduled for physical therapy, occupational therapy, speech therapy and recreational therapy appointments on a daily basis, including ensuring that patients meet with required amount of minutes per insurance guidelines within a seven day period. Ensure that each therapist receives a daily schedule and that patients receive a daily schedule. Support team members in their daily roles and communicate clearly any needed information to concerned parties. Assists with wheelchair assignments and maintenance.
Essential Duties:
This job description is intended to cover the minimum essential duties assigned on a regular basis. Associates may be asked to perform additional duties as assigned by their leader. Leadership has the right to alter or modify the duties of the position.
- Reviews new admissions for ordered therapy services
- Schedules patient appointments with appropriate disciplines and staff, making note of evaluations, discharges, and family training and scheduling appropriately.
- Completes team conference scheduling each week
- Communicates within the team to all involved parties any discharges or admissions to the floor
- Communicates within the team any unplanned schedule interruptions
- Works with leadership to ensure adequate staffing levels for each shift
- Compiles daily schedules for therapists, ensuring that productivity expectations are met
- Compiles daily schedules for patients, ensuring that required therapy minutes are met each seven day period per insurance guidelines
- Maintain accurate floor sheets and distribute accordingly
- Communicate with all team members to coordinate delivery of therapy services in accordance with required therapy minute guidelines.
- Provide appropriate wheelchairs to patients and maintain all wheelchairs and wheelchair parts.
- Perform and document cleaning and maintenance activities according to department standards. These include but are not limited to cleaning treatment areas, stocking clean linens, removing dirty linens, disinfecting patient care equipment, and performing routine maintenance checks.
- Assist in the provision of therapy interventions under the supervision of a staff PT, PTA, OTR, or COTA. Therapy interventions include but are not limited to: modality assistance, equipment and treatment area set up and clean up, aquatic therapy program assistance, assistance with ambulation, transfers, wheelchair mobility, and mat activities and assistance with ADLs and table top activities.
- Transport patients between therapy gyms/treatment rooms and patient rooms.
- Communicate verbally with the responsible clinician regarding the patient's feedback related to designated intervention.
- Seek ways to continually improve the value of our services and maximize our customers' rehabilitation potential by actively participating in activities such as in-services, staff meetings, team meetings, and continuing education courses.
- Maximize customer satisfaction by treating our customers with respect and responding to their needs in a prompt, friendly, and courteous manner.
- Follows all hospital policy and procedures related to infection control
- Supports program operations as assigned.
